CHW12 Naming Cycloalkanes Cycloalkanes are alkanes that are bound together in a cyclic form. When naming cycloalkanes in IUPAC nomenclature, the cyclic portion of the molecule determines the name of the molecule. Cycloalkanes are named like alkanes, except the prefix cyclo is …

Baeyer observed different bond angles for different cycloalkanes and also observed some different properties and stability. On this basis, he proposed angle strain theory. The theory explains reactivity and stability of cycloalkanes.
